Tip of the Week Hang Good Laundry to Dry for Energy Savings

By good laundry, I mean dress clothing such as shirts, dresses, tops and pants. I usually hang shirts or fold pants over the hanger the same as I would to store them, then place the hangers where the items can dry overnight. Best place is where air can circulate freely around them. Then store them in your closet the next morning when they're dry.

Hanging these good items to dry has more benefits than merely saving on dryer use and energy, it keeps them looking nicer longer. You're also saving a handling step between drying and folding, and I seldom have to iron because air drying on hangers cuts down on wrinkles.

Tip: Use only non-metal hangers though to ensure no rust on your garments.

Want even more energy savings? Hang your entire wash outdoors to dry.
